The DAEDALUS project develops advanced 4D biomaterials that respond to environmental stimuli to promote healing of the colorectal mucosa and submucosa. By integrating synthetic and natural polymers, these materials aim to provide a minimally invasive alternative to traditional surgical procedures, enhancing patient rec…
4D biomaterials enable new surgical treatments by autonomously acting in response to environmental stimuli, thus overcoming the limitations of standard medical strategies. DAEDALUS has the ambitious goal to develop two advanced 4D composite biomaterials designed to facilitate the re-epithelization of the colorectal mucosa and submucosa after their removal.
